## Where the baseline file comes from

Hey, welcome aboard! The `lintwall.baseline` file in the Cobblefern repo isn't hand-edited — ever. It's regenerated by the Sagemont static-analysis job whenever someone intentionally accepts new findings, and the job stamps provenance metadata into the file header so we can prove which pipeline produced it. If the header looks off, ping the tooling crew before merging. You can verify authenticity by checking the token recorded just below.

session token of tajef-bageg = htk21_5d90d574934f3ccae6437

## Deployment Notes for Plugin Authors

Glimmerauth v2.9 fixes a bug where session tokens refreshed twice within one grace window, silently invalidating the first token. Plugins calling the refresh hook directly must update to the batched endpoint before deploying against production. Behavior depends on the refresh settings, so confirm your host runs the values below.

deployment values, yadug-bawif:
[framir]
team = pelox
access_code = ac_a38ab2
owner = tamion.julael
host = framir.tolvaqlabs.test
port = 11211
peer = tammir.zemvargrid.local
salt = 2215ef03
pin = 1541

## Querybridge Environments

After the N+1 fix in resolver batching, staging and production now share the same dataloader settings; the dev environment still allows unbatched queries for debugging. Support: if customers report slow nested queries, confirm they're hitting production, not dev. Each environment runs with the following configuration values.

settings of tagef-bawif:
DRUIX_HOST=druix.zemvarlabs.internal
DRUIX_PORT=8000

Visitor Policy — Temporary Site, Wrenfield Annex

While Harlow Point undergoes renovation, all Dunmore Fabrication staff and contractors operate from the Wrenfield Annex. Visiting contractors must sign in at the portacabin by the south gate, wear hi-vis at all times, and remain with their escort outside designated work zones. Deliveries go to Bay 2 only. To enter the contractor compound, use the gate code below.

turnstile pass: bdg-QZV-3